If the first letter is replaced by its next letter in
the alphabets and second letter is replaced by its previous letter in the alphabets, then which of the following would be the second word in dictionary order? The following questions are based on the five three letter words given below: AHYÂ Â Â Â Â Â CGMÂ Â Â Â Â STQ Â Â Â Â Â Â Â Â ILOÂ Â Â Â Â Â Â WEF (Note: The words formed after applying the given operations may or may not be meaningful English words.)Solution
Given words: Â AHY Â CGM Â STQ Â Â ILO Â Â WEF On applying operations: BGY Â DFM Â TSQ Â JKO Â XDF Dictionary order: BGY Â DFM Â JKO Â TSQ Â XDF Second word in dictionary order is DFM Â . Hence, option 4 is the answer.
